Neuware - THE FORESTWinter break is supposed to mean freedom.Instead, one wrong turn and one black van later, a kid is dumped into a place that should not exist anymore: a real forest.It is not normal.The trees feel wrong. Time feels wrong. The silence feels like it is listening.He wakes up with supp…lies he did not pack and a torn map that makes no sense, then learns the first rule the hard way: Whatever comes in. never comes out.As night falls, the forest wakes up.Something circles. Something sniffs. Something waits.To survive, he will have to: - - find food before hunger makes him reckless- - find shelter before the dark finds him first- - follow the map before the forest shifts again- - figure out who else has been here and what happened to themMiddle-grade adventure and suspense with fast pacing, mystery, and survival in a world where nature is almost gone.Perfect for readers who love eerie forests, nonstop tension, and brave kids forced to outthink what is hunting them.
